† Bela (Haedropleura) orientalis Vredenburg 1923 Haedropleura orientalis is an extinct species of sea snail, a marine gastropod mollusk in the family Horaiclavidae.
[1] The length of the shell attains 33.7 mm.
This extinct species occurs in Paleocene strata of India; age range: 58.7 to 55.8 Ma
